The Monastery of Panagia Skopiotissa, located on the picturesque island of Zakynthos (Zante), Greece, is a revered spiritual site dedicated to the Virgin Mary. Nestled on the slopes of Mount Skopos, this historic monastery offers stunning panoramic views of the surrounding landscape, including the crystal-clear waters of the Ionian Sea and the lush greenery of the island. Established in the 18th century, the monastery features a traditional architectural style, with whitewashed walls, a charming courtyard, and beautifully adorned chapels that reflect the island's rich religious heritage. Its serene setting and spiritual significance make it a popular destination for both pilgrims and tourists seeking tranquillity.

Visitors to the Monastery of Panagia Skopiotissa can explore its peaceful grounds and experience the rich history that permeates the site. The main church, or katholikon, is adorned with exquisite frescoes and icons that showcase the artistry and devotion of the monks who once inhabited the monastery. The site is also home to a small museum containing religious artifacts, manuscripts, and memorabilia that illustrate the monastery's role in the spiritual and cultural life of Zakynthos. The surrounding area offers hiking trails,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in the natural beauty of Mount Skopos while discovering hidden viewpoints and lush landscapes.
